Well, as far as I'm concerned (I'm no expert either ;)) fanfiction is a story you write about one of your Skyrim characters. Writing about their adventures makes you exciting to go out there and experience more. In my case the whole Skyrim experience got more realistic thanks to fanfiction.

If you want to have fun in Skyrim when not doing quests you'll have to use your fantasy and be creative. You could come up with your own quests. There are plenty of locations and NPC's you can use. Of course it won't get you a reward but it at least gives you something to do.
I also like traveling. Not fast travel, just wandering through the wilds of Skyrim. Search a map of Skyrim on Google and mark the locations you want to visit. You can choose to whipe out all the Imperial/Stormcloak camps you can find on your map. Just something I do every once in a while. :)
It's also a good idea to create more characters than just one. I have one character who joined the Thieves Guild, the Imperials and the Dark Brotherhood and another character who joined the Blades, the Stormcloaks and the Companions. There are lots of choices and decisions you can make in Skyrim. And making different decisions can give you a totally different adventure / experience..
